Bestiary Ceiling
Bestiary ceiling, Metz, France, (1928). '13th Century...Detail of a painted ceiling...from a building in the Poncelet Strasse...now in the Metz Town Museum [Musée de La Cour d'Or]...one of the oldest painted ceilings preserved or known at the present time'. The house belonged to the chapter of the collegiate church of Notre-Dame-la-Ronde. After R. Borrmann. Plate LXVII, fig 143, from "An Encyclopaedia of Colour Decoration from the Earliest Times to the Middle of the XIXth Century" with explanatory text by Helmuth Bossert. [Ernst Wasmuth Ltd., Berlin, 1928]. Creator Unknown. (Photo by The Print Collector/Heritage Images via Getty Images)
